[QUOTE="BountyHunter, post: 576387, member: 12"] what? Same bullet selection for the WSM. both are 30 calibers. the WSM will take higher pressure and gets equal if not better MV to the Win Mag. Winchester factory ballistics give the edge (not by much) to the WSM in fact. So case capacity is moot and not indicator. Both will run neck and neck. Both will easily run 210s at 2850 to over 3000 depending on the gun, barrel and which powder. 2850-2875 is the accuracy node most 1k shooters use for the WSM BTW, but there is a higher node from 2950-3025 also. On the WSM, MRP will give the higher velocities normally. [/QUOTE]
